Jerusalem vs Dubai: The Short Version

  • Rent is 49% cheaper in Jerusalem ($1478/mo vs $2200/mo for a 1BR city centre).
  • Summers are dramatically warmer in Dubai (41°C vs 29°C).
  • Dubai is safer by homicide rate (0.5 vs 1.6 per 100k).
  • Jerusalem scores higher on democracy (7.8 vs 2.8 / 10 EIU).
  • English is easier to get by in Dubai (63/100 vs 55/100 English proficiency).

Jerusalem vs Dubai — Common Questions

Is Jerusalem cheaper than Dubai?

Jerusalem is cheaper. A 1-bedroom apartment in city centre costs around $1478/month in Jerusalem vs $2200/month in the other city (Numbeo data).

Which is safer, Jerusalem or Dubai?

Dubai is statistically safer based on UNODC homicide data. Jerusalem has a rate of 1.63 per 100,000 and Dubai has 0.49 per 100,000.

Is it easier to get residency in Jerusalem or Dubai?

Jerusalem: Israel Work Visa (B/1) (moderate requirements, 1 year (renewable)). Dubai: UAE Remote Work Visa (moderate requirements, 1 year (renewable)). See each city's profile page for full requirements.

Which has better weather, Jerusalem or Dubai?

Dubai is warmer in summer (41°C vs 29°C). Jerusalem has milder summers, which suits those who prefer cooler weather. Climate preference is personal — use the weather section above to compare seasons.

Can I live in Jerusalem or Dubai without speaking the local language?

English is easier to get by in Dubai (EF EPI score: 63/100) than in Jerusalem (55/100). In Dubai, daily life and professional settings often work in English. In Jerusalem, learning some of the local language will make long-term settlement significantly smoother.
